What makes Eaton Street so special in Key West?
Eaton Street in Key West, Florida, offers a unique blend of historic charm, beautiful architecture, and a glimpse into local life. It's less crowded than Duval Street, allowing for a more relaxed experience while still being close to many attractions.
Where exactly is Eaton Street located?
Eaton Street runs east to west across Key West, from the Historic Seaport on one end to near the Higgs Beach area on the other. It's centrally located and easy to access from various parts of the island.
What kind of businesses can I expect to find on Eaton Street?
You'll find a mix of art galleries, boutiques, restaurants, and historic homes along Eaton Street in Key West, Florida. It offers a more curated and less tourist-trap-oriented shopping and dining experience.
